PhD, Center for Data-intensive Systems, Aalborg University

A fully funded three-year Ph.D. position is available at the Center for Data-intensive Systems (http://daisy.aau.dk), Department of Computer Science, Aalborg University (AAU), Denmark. The position is available for start over the summer/fall of 2016.

Research topic:
More and more data is published on the Web as RDF or Linked Open Data. Available datasets are naturally distributed, constantly changing, and have been published at different times, by different communities, in different languages, etc. We are looking for a talented and motivated PhD student whose work will help overcome these challenges and enable efficient query processing over Web data.

About Ph.D. studies at Aalborg University:
Danish universities offer high Ph.D. salaries (and good social benefits) that compare very well with the rest of the world. The monthly pre-tax salary including pension contribution at Aalborg University is approximately DKK 29,000. To broaden their research horizons, Ph.D. candidates at Aalborg University are also given financial support for a one-semester academic visit to an international research institution.
